Russian Qt Forum
Ноябрь 15, 2024, 21:51 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Вкладки -> каскад, каскад -> вкладки  (Прочитано 3705 раз)
PulSar.CE3194694
Гость
« : Июнь 22, 2010, 12:29 »

Добрый день!
Подскажите плиз, как можно переводить вкладки, которые находятся в главном окне в окна каскадом и наоборот в вкладки? какие классы следует посмотреть например?

Заранее спасибо.
Записан
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« Ответ #1 : Июнь 22, 2010, 14:59 »

>>как можно переводить вкладки, которые находятся в главном окне в окна каскадом и наоборот в вкладки?
из этого предложения ни чего не понял

Записан

Юра.
PulSar.CE3194694
Гость
« Ответ #2 : Июнь 22, 2010, 15:27 »

Есть программа. В ней вызываю диалоговое окно, в которое ввожу данные. Далее по этим данным проводится расчет и строиться график. По умолчанию для этого графика в главном окне должна создаваться вкладка, и в ней painter рисует. Мы ввели несколько типов данных - создались несколько вкладок в главном окне. Далее мне потребовалось эти вкладки превратить в окна, отображающиеся каскадом. Как это сделать?
Аналогичная ситуация:потребовалось из этих окон, в которых нарисованы графики, создать вкладки в главном окне. Как это сделать?
Записан
lit-uriy
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 3880


Просмотр профиля WWW
« Ответ #3 : Июнь 22, 2010, 16:05 »

смотри свойство
QMdiArea::viewMode
и слот:
QMdiArea::cascadeSubWindows()
Записан

Юра.
Kolobok
Гость
« Ответ #4 : Июнь 22, 2010, 16:16 »

Посмотри еще QMainWindow и QDockWidget. С ними можно тоже что-то похожее сделать.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.127 секунд. Запросов: 23.